Epilepsy: Higher doses of THC could trigger seizures in those with epilepsy. There are already several studies where superior doses of cannabis that contains THC have prompted seizures.
Cardiovascular disease: THC could bring about fast heartbeat and higher blood pressure. It may additionally raise the hazard of having a heart attack.
THC could possibly slow blood clotting. Having THC along with medications that also gradual blood clotting could raise the possibility of bruising and bleeding.
